Output eb94e6c617b3ac0767e4ba4e40dd870b655163498263b15db9aa3ad51dc965ea:0

value
357925608
script pubkey
OP_0 OP_PUSHBYTES_20 24c3435862438af2dbbcb9998ce51fe57164f078
address
ltc1qynp5xkrzgw909kauhxvceeglu4ckfurcsct4r2
transaction
eb94e6c617b3ac0767e4ba4e40dd870b655163498263b15db9aa3ad51dc965ea
spent
true